What is the cost of living in Waite Park, MN?

According to the most recent data on the cost of living, Waite Park has an overall cost of living index of 96, which is 1.0x lower than the national index of 100.

Compared to Minnesota, Waite Park has a cost of living index that's 1.0x lower than Minnesota's index of 101.

The standard of living in Waite Park ranks as #24 most affordable out of the 151 places we measured in Minnesota. By definition, that implies Waite Park ranks as the #127 most expensive place in the North Star State.

Housing swings affordability the most between places in Minnesota, so we broke down housing costs into more detail. Home and income data comes from the most recent US Census ACS 2020-2024. The key points are:

  • The Median Home Value in Waite Park is $249,244.

  • The Median Rent in Waite Park is $1,117.

  • The Median Income in Waite Park is $59,285.

  • The Home Value To Income in Waite Park is 4.2x.

  • The Rent To Monthly Income in Waite Park is 0.23x.

Statistic Waite Park Minnesota United States
Median Home Value $249,244 $346,667 $332,700
Median Rent $1,117 $1,280 $1,413
Median Income $59,285 $89,062 $80,734
Home Value To Income 4.2x 3.9x 4.1x
Rent To Monthly Income 0.23x 0.17x 0.21x
